IRS head apologizes to ID theft victims
The commissioner of the Internal Revenue Service offered a public apology Thursday to taxpayers who have had their names and social security numbers used to claim fraudulent refunds. The IRS is working to strengthen its internal controls to prevent it from issuing such refunds in the future.

DoD still working to tighten SSN controls
The Defense Department continues to scrub service members' social security numbers from public DoD websites. The armed services plan to transition to an alternative ID number system by 2012.

GSA employees on alert after data breach
General Service Administration employees are on alert for identity theft after an employee accidentally sent the names and social security numbers of the agency's entire staff to a private email address.
